as a new diver doing a flutter kick in Jets you'll really work your ankles and leg muscles - took my legs/feet a couple weeks to get used to them, but worth the effort.

They really start to shine doing Frog, reverse and helicopter kicks - Some also like the fact that they are negative for helping to trim out, others find they need more weight up "north" and need less bouyant fins (or more lead by the tank valve/cam bands if available)

btw - if you found them to be small they might have been medium or large Jets as both are quite short. XL and XXL Jets are several inches longer.
